How to remove dental fluorosis?

1. Whitening teeth stickers

The latest and most popular teeth whitening method is convenient, fast, simple and cheap. It has been popularized in foreign countries for a long time. The clinical effect is still quite obvious and it has a tendency to gradually replace bleaching. However, whitening teeth strips are not suitable for teeth with discolored dentin due to tetracycline, fluorosis, etc.

2. Cold light whitening technology

The bleaching agent covering the tooth surface is irradiated with a special cold light source, allowing it to penetrate into the hard tissue of the tooth in a short period of time to achieve the purpose of changing the color of the teeth. Its advantage is that it does not damage the hard tissue of the tooth and the operation treatment time is about 30 to 45 minutes. However, the disadvantage is that due to the bleaching effect of the drug, the bleaching effect varies from person to person.

3. Teeth cleaning

Many people think that teeth cleaning is a cosmetic whitening of teeth. In fact, the main function of teeth cleaning is not whitening, but a routine dental care method. It is a routine health care method that mainly prevents caries, gums, and periodontal diseases, targeting tartar and plaque on the surface of teeth. Cleaning your teeth through regular teeth cleaning once every six months is a good habit to maintain dental health. Although the purpose of teeth cleaning is not to whiten teeth, teeth will naturally look whiter after cleaning.

4. Whitening toothpaste

Basically, it does not have much whitening effect. It is mainly through physical friction between the abrasive and the stains on the surface of the teeth. Some whitening toothpastes also contain oxidants, but due to the small content of chemical ingredients, the general short brushing time, and the easy loss of effectiveness after being left for a long time, the whitening effect is very small.

How to take care of your teeth

Oral care experts recommend brushing your teeth for 2-3 minutes each time. The correct way to brush your teeth is to brush up and down, that is, brush the upper teeth from the gums downwards, and brush the lower teeth from the gums upwards. Be careful not to brush sideways. Because brushing horizontally cannot remove the dirt between the teeth, it will cause the dirt to erode the tooth enamel and easily damage the gums.

Use mouthwash. Because it can give your mouth a comprehensive final cleansing. When using mouthwash, you should let it stay in your mouth for at least 30 seconds, then rinse your mouth up and down and left and right.

Try to brush your teeth at night. Brushing your teeth before going to bed at night is more important than brushing your teeth in the morning. This is because the saliva secretion in the mouth decreases after falling asleep, the self-cleaning function of the teeth is poor, and bacteria can easily grow. Therefore, brushing your teeth before going to bed plays a more important role in removing dental plaque and preventing dental diseases.

You should reduce the number of times you eat sugary foods, because there are many bacteria that accumulate on the teeth and gum edges. The bacteria use sugar to produce acid, which erodes the teeth and causes tooth decay.
